vue tinymce
时间: 2023-08-19 11:06:50 浏览: 116
Vue-Tinymce 是一个基于 TinyMCE 富文本编辑器的 Vue 组件。它提供了一个简单的方式来在 Vue 应用中集成和使用 TinyMCE。
要使用 Vue-Tinymce,首先需要安装它。你可以通过 npm 或 yarn 进行安装:
```
npm install vue-tinymce
```
然后,在你的 Vue 组件中引入和使用 Vue-Tinymce:
```vue
<template>
<div>
<vue-tinymce v-model="content" :init="tinymceConfig"></vue-tinymce>
</div>
</template>
<script>
import VueTinymce from 'vue-tinymce';
export default {
components: {
VueTinymce,
},
data() {
return {
content: '',
tinymceConfig: {
// 配置项
},
};
},
};
</script>
```
在上面的示例中,我们首先导入了 VueTinymce 组件,然后在组件中注册并使用它。在 data 中,我们定义了一个变量来存储编辑器的内容,并且通过 v-model 指令将这个变量与编辑器进行双向绑定。我们还可以通过 `:init` 属性传递 TinyMCE 的配置项。
你可以根据你的需求来配置 `tinymceConfig` 对象,具体的配置项可以参考 TinyMCE 的官方文档:https://www.tiny.cloud/docs/configure/
Vue-Tinymce 还提供了一些事件和方法,可以用来处理编辑器的变化、获取内容等操作。你可以根据需要在组件中进行相应的处理。
希望这个简单的示例能够帮助你开始使用 Vue-Tinymce 这个富文本编辑器插件。
阅读全文